Main Purpose of Job
This is a contractual position responsible for providing program and fiscal management for grants and contracts for the Division of Early Childhood Development's Collaboration and Program Improvement Branch which includes program and fiscal monitoring and overseeing the financial procedures impacting grants and contracts for the Branch.
POSITION DUTIES
Prepares solicitation to acquire early childhood services in accordance with established procurement processes and DECD/CPIB strategies for submission to Branch Chief and DECD Assistant Superintendent. Monitor grants and contracts to ensure compliance with program specifications, fiscal and spending requirements. Reviews and approves invoices from grantees/contractors. Determines program needs for funding and recommends strategies for meeting program objectives and implementation plans. Provides technical assistance to local school systems, head start agencies and the child care community financial officers, agency heads and other division employees.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
EDUCATION: Bachelor’s Degree from an accredited college or university in business, finance, accounting or a related area is required.
EXPERIENCE: Two (2) years of professional experience in grant evaluation and monitoring or budget preparation, development, presentation and execution.
NOTES: 1. Applicants may substitute graduate education in business, accounting, economics, finance, political science or public administration at a rate of 30 credit hours for each year of experience. 2. Applicants may substitute additional experience on a year for year basis for the required education.
